New Data Shows 无码专区 Increases Supplier Diversity

A diverse-owned business speaking with 无码专区 officials at a past Supplier Diversity Day

The 无码专区鈥檚 strategic initiative to increase spending with businesses owned by minorities, women and veterans has resulted in significant gains, according to new data compiled from 无码专区鈥檚 most recent fiscal year.

In 2018-19, 无码专区 spent nearly $35 million with diverse suppliers, an increase of nearly $8 million from the previous year and almost double the amount from 2016-17 ($18 million). Overall, 8.7 percent of the university鈥檚 competitively sourced purchases last year were made with diverse suppliers. 

The improvements continue a pattern of consistent growth since early 2017 when 无码专区 implemented a university-wide emphasis on working more closely with businesses owned by minorities, women and veterans to provide ample opportunities to compete for providing 无码专区 with goods and supplies, construction services and professional services. Over that time, 无码专区 has spent more than $80 million dollars with diverse-owned suppliers.

鈥淭he 无码专区 is deeply committed to supporting diversity and inclusion, including with the Tampa Bay region鈥檚 business community,鈥 said Terrie Daniel, assistant vice president of supplier diversity, who joined 无码专区 in April 2017. 鈥淥ur results can be attributed to the hard work of many dedicated people and our university leadership, including new 无码专区 President Steve Currall, who has expressed his support for continuing this important initiative.鈥

Daniel and her team continue to focus on outreach efforts and expanding programming opportunities for businesses to learn more about the university鈥檚 procurement processes and how they might be able to work with a large organization like 无码专区. The office of supplier diversity also educates 无码专区 staff and faculty on best practices for considering minority, woman and veteran-owned businesses when making purchases.

无码专区 will hold its third annual supplier diversity day on Friday, Oct. 4. The all-day event brings together the Tampa Bay region鈥檚 business community with key purchasers from 无码专区, aiming to strengthen relationships, further educate vendors about the university鈥檚 procurement process and offer guidance for successfully competing for future business opportunities at 无码专区.
